To order the topics from broadest to narrowest, we need to consider the scope of each topic in relation to the others. The broadest topic would encompass the largest amount of information, while the narrowest would be the most specific. Here's how we can order these topics:
- Representations of California by California-born authors
- Representations of California by John Steinbeck
- Representations of California in East of Eden
The first topic is the broadest because it includes any representations of California by all authors who were born in the state. The second topic narrows the focus to one particular author, John Steinbeck, a notable California-born author and thus is narrower in scope than the first. The third topic is the narrowest because it looks specifically at representations of California within the context of a single work by Steinbeck, East of Eden, offering the most focused scope of these three topics.
